  This newspaper reports (by reporter Teng Shikuang): On January 4, the People’s Government of Qujing City, the Management Committee of the Qujing Economic and Technological Development Zone, and Shenzhen Defang Nano Technology Co., Ltd. signed an investment agreement for a project to build a production base with an annual capacity of 330,000 metric tons of next-generation phosphate-based cathode materials.

  According to reports, the newly signed project to build a production base for novel phosphate-based cathode materials with an annual capacity of 330,000 tonnes involves a total investment of approximately RMB 7.5 billion, which will lay an even stronger foundation for Qujing’s accelerated development into a nationally significant hub for new-energy battery manufacturing.
